FAQs

How can I use "effort on this" in a sentence?

You can use "effort on this" to describe dedication or resources applied to a specific task or problem. For example, "A significant "effort on this" project is required to meet the deadline."

What are some alternatives to "effort on this"?

Depending on the context, you can use phrases like "endeavor in this matter", "commitment to this issue", or "focus on this task" as alternatives to "effort on this".

Is "effort in this" a suitable alternative to "effort on this"?

While "effort in this" might be grammatically correct in some contexts, "effort on this" is more commonly used and generally preferred, especially when referring to a specific task or issue.

What's the difference between "making an effort on this" and "putting effort into this"?

"Making an effort on this" is generally used when referring to initiating or demonstrating dedication. "Putting effort into this" implies sustained dedication and investment of resources. The choice depends on whether you are emphasizing initiation or continuation.
